1 / 58
文档名称:

分布式内存数据库事务管理的设计与实现.pdf

格式:pdf   页数:58
下载后只包含 1 个 PDF 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

分布式内存数据库事务管理的设计与实现.pdf

上传人:cherry 2014/3/17 文件大小:0 KB

下载得到文件列表

分布式内存数据库事务管理的设计与实现.pdf

文档介绍

文档介绍:北京邮电大学
硕士学位论文
分布式内存数据库事务管理的设计与实现
姓名:王玮
申请学位级别:硕士
专业:计算机科学与技术
指导教师:杨正球
20060327
分布式内存数据库事务管理的设计与实现摘要分布式内存数据库实体事务管理并发控制关键词近年来,随着数据库技术的迅速发展,以三大经典系统为代表的传统数据库技术对于管理结构简单、操作简单、完全格式和结构化且较稳定的数据已经证明是很成功的,在一类传统商务和管理的事务性应用领域中获得了普遍和有效的应用。然而数据库应用正在并将继续从传统领域不断地迅速向新的领域扩展,这些现代应用要求新型的现代数据库系统支持,同时还要求系统有高性能,尤其是保证“硬实时”这样的性能要求,传统的常驻磁盘数据库系统对这些是无能为力的。这就要求我们在现有资源的基础上研究开发~种适应现代应用要求的新型数据库系统。而目前,大多数中小型企业内部,都具各了一定的网络资源,拥有大量的计算机设备。但是,当大部分计算机处于正常工作状态时,其内存资源并未得到充分利用。本文提出的分布式内存数据库系统,结合了内存数据库和分布式数据库的特点,利用分布式内存结构与共享存储结构的优点,具有可扩充性、通用性、方便性。分布式内存数据库系统结合椋迪至烁咝实摹⒙嘲舻暮透涸仄胶獾数据存储管理功能,系统采用了完全分布式体系结构,没有服务器或中心节点,很容易扩展到大规模网络应用,系统核心分为三层:通信层、实体层和数据包层,并设计实现了分布式事务的管理机制,及并发控制功能。希望通过论文的工作进一步了解它对于解决目前面临问题的可行性,以求对今后工作有所帮助。分布式内存数据库事务管理的设计与寰现北京邮电大学埘小学位论义
.”猂分布式内存数据库事务管理的蛙畄;现珼瓾,甤琣,甪,,.,甧”瓼,瓵.‘瑄:,,.,甌拢篿猚甧.
蔓⋯坠垫查兰塑:兰堡堡兰坌塑垄堕壹垫塑壁皇墨笪型堕堡生苎壅些,.
本人签名:日期:垒:墨里日期:了一;.五抽关于论文使用授权的说明声明独创性虼葱滦声明保密论文注释:本学位论文属于保密在一年解密后适用本授权书。非保密本人声明所呈交的论文是本人在导师指导下进行的研究工作及取得的研究成果。尽我所知,除了文中特别加以标注和致谢中所罗列的内容以外,论文中不包含其他人已经发表或撰写过的研究成果,也不包含为获得北京邮电大学或其他教育机构的学位或证书而使用过的材料。与我一鞯耐径员狙芯所做的任何贡献均已在论文中作了明确的说明并表示了谢意。申请学位论文与资料若有不实之处,本人承担一切相关责任。学位论文作者完全了解北京邮电大学有关保留和使用学位论文的规定,即:研究生在校攻读学位期间论文工作的知识产权单位属北京邮电大学。学校有权保留并向国家有关部门或机构送交论文的复印件和磁盘,允许学位论文被查匍和借阅;学校可以公布学位论文的全部或部分内容,可以允许采用影印、缩印或其它复制手段保存、汇编学位论文。C艿难宦畚脑诮饷芎笞袷卮论文注释:本学位论文不属于保密范围,适用本授权书。本人签名导师签名规定
第一章引言钅恳庖随着通信技术的飞速发展,信息的海量存储与实时处理,对设备的性能要求越来越高。但是,无论多大的磁盘空间,从最初的几郊甘瓽,发展到现在的几百贾栈故遣荒苈闼械男枨蟆H欢チM姆⒄谷闯晌R桓龀晒的例子,网上每时每刻都有大量的信息、数据在传输,但是却不会发生由于数据量太大而导致整个互联网崩溃的情况。究其原由,数据的分布存储,使得用户能够在充分利用存储资源的同时,又能够动态的共享数据。因此,本文提出的分布式内存数据库系统,正是基于这种既能够充分利用内存资源,又可以实现动态共享数据的存储管理方式。现在,大多数通信企业内部,都已经具备了一定的局域网络资源,计算机设备的数量,从几台到几十台、上百台甚至更多。而事实上,在硬件技术迅速发展的今天,计算机的内存容量也已经不可忽视了,但是,当大部分计算机处于正常工作状态时,其内存资源并未得到充分利用。从另一方面看来,尽管通信业务的数据量越来越大,用户对于通信系统的即时处理要求,却也越来越高。虽然许多数据库软件都具备了较为完善的数据处理能力,但是由于普通的数据库操作都属于磁盘读写,因此,在处理海量数据的时候,就会不可避免的产生较大的时延。而内存的存取速度,远远超过了磁盘读写,局域网的带宽电不会产生太大的时延。此外,数据库软件对计算机的性能要求非常高,一般都是由专门的服务器来运行数据库软件的。因此,我们提出了这样一个在局域网范围的内存资源上,建立数据库存储的解决方案,就是为了能够充分利用内存和局域网的带宽优势,使那些已经具备了相关设备的通信企业,能够充分利用所具备资源,而不必再添置额外的服务器设备,从而拥有更高的数据管理效率。因此,我们提出了分布式内存数据库系统的设计思想,采用樽魑其底层的通